Average storage prices in 28570 (updated October 2025)
With prices starting at $25, you’ll find everything from compact locker-sized units to large spaces for cars, RVs or household goods.
Prices typically vary depending on the unit size and whether it’s climate controlled.
| Unit Size | Non-Climate-Controlled Units | Climate-Controlled Units |
|---|---|---|
| 5x5 | - | $57 |
| 5x10 | $56 | $72 |
| 10x10 | $79 | $97 |
| 10x15 | $111 | $132 |
| 10x20 | $147 | $160 |
| 10x30 | $244 | $244 |
| 20x30 | $456 | $456 |
| Average (all sizes) | $174 | $79 |
Note: Street rate data provided by Yardi Matrix.

Types of storage available in 28570
Standard Non-Climate Controlled Units: Non-climate-controlled storage units are suitable for items that aren't sensitive to humidity or temperature fluctuations. These units may be located either inside a building or outdoors – outdoor units often feature drive-up access for convenient loading and unloading.
In 28570, you can rent a non-climate-controlled storage unit for an average of $$79 per month.
Climate-Controlled Units: Climate-controlled units maintain consistent temperature and humidity levels year-round, protecting everything from electronics and wooden furniture to antiques, artwork, books and important documents.
You’ll find 7 self storage facilities in 28570 offering climate-controlled units in a variety of sizes and price points.
The average rate for a 10'x10' climate-controlled storage unit in 28570 is around $97 per month — a smart investment to ensure your valuables stay protected.
Vehicle Storage Options: Perfect for outdoor adventurers, seasonal travelers and classic car collectors, specialized storage spaces offer a secure place to store cars, SUVs, vans, RVs, boats and other types of vehicles.

How to choose the right storage unit in 28570
Here are a few simple things to keep in mind when choosing a storage unit in 28570:
- Think about the weather
- If you’re storing things like electronics, wooden furniture or photos, go with a climate-controlled unit to keep them safe.
- Check when you can get in
- Need late-night access? Some places offer 24/7 entry, while others stick to regular business hours. Make sure you pick a facility whose opening hours work for your schedule.
- Make sure it feels secure
- Look for places with gated access, security cameras and someone on-site. It’s your stuff — you want it protected.
- Shop around for deals
- Prices can vary a lot. It’s worth checking a few places – some even offer discounts for your first month.
- See what others are saying
- Online reviews can give you the real scoop on customer service, cleanliness, and how a facility treats its renters.
- Don’t forget about insurance
- Most storage places require it. Some offer it themselves, or you might already be covered through your renters or homeowners insurance.
Take a few minutes to check these things off your list, and you’ll be set up with a storage unit that actually works for you — without overpaying or guessing.
Frequently asked questions
How safe is self storage?
Most self storage facilities have some level of security, often including surveillance cameras and gated access. Popular security features include video surveillance and secure entry systems. Know that the facility comes with a strong security setup can give you confidence that your belongings are safe until you need them again.
What is climate-controlled storage?
Climate-controlled storage refers to a type of storage where temperature and humidity. The primary goal of climate control is to protect your belongings from environmental damage. Items that are sensitive or fragile, like furniture, appliances or antiques, aren't built to endure fluctuations in temperature and humidity. Without climate control, a standard self storage unit can expose these types of possessions to common damage like mold, mildew, rust, and corrosion.
What items cannot be put in storage?
Generally, avoid storing plants, food, live animals, hazardous and wet items among other. However, ask the facility you plan on renting from to find out the specific list of items that can't be put in storage.
Can I go to my storage unit anytime?
Access to your unit can vary depending on the facility. Some self storage locations offer 24/7 access, while others limit entry to specific operating hours that can vary. It's also a good idea to ask what their access schedule prior renting a unit to see if it matches your needs.
